Why Warehouse Demand Is Rising in Pune in 2026: Chakan, Talegaon, Ranjangaon & Other Emerging Logistics Hubs
Pune's commercial real estate market is experiencing strong demand across offices, retail and industrial properties, but one segment attracting increasing attention in 2026 is warehousing. The combination of manufacturing growth, e-commerce, third-party logistics, organized distribution networks and improving regional connectivity is creating new requirements for strategically located warehouse space. Recent industry data highlights the scale of this trend. Pune's industrial and logistics market recorded more than 2 million sq. ft. of leasing during the first half of 2026, with warehousing demand supported strongly by third-party logistics providers, e-commerce and quick-commerce businesses. Chakan continued to be the leading industrial and logistics corridor, while Talegaon, Ranjangaon and other locations also recorded activity. For companies planning distribution centres, manufacturing support facilities or inventory hubs, choosing the right warehouse location has therefore become an important business decision rather than simply a real estate requirement.
Why Pune Is Becoming an Important Warehousing Market
Pune has several characteristics that make it attractive for logistics and industrial businesses. The city has a strong manufacturing base, a large consumer market and connectivity to important cities and industrial corridors across Maharashtra. The presence of automobile, engineering, electronics, manufacturing and technology companies generates continuous demand for storage and distribution facilities. At the same time, e-commerce and quick-commerce businesses require warehouses that can support faster deliveries and efficient inventory management.
This combination has created demand for different types of warehouse properties, ranging from large industrial facilities to smaller distribution centres positioned closer to major consumption markets. The latest market intelligence indicates that Pune's warehousing activity is being driven particularly by 3PL providers, while e-commerce and quick-commerce companies are also expanding their distribution networks.


Chakan has established itself as one of the most important industrial and logistics destinations in Pune. Its established manufacturing ecosystem and strategic position make it particularly attractive to businesses that require warehouse space close to factories, suppliers and transportation routes. The area has a strong presence of automotive and engineering businesses, creating demand for raw material storage, finished goods warehouses, spare parts distribution and manufacturing support facilities.

Companies considering Chakan should evaluate warehouse specifications carefully, including floor loading capacity, clear height, loading and unloading areas, truck movement, power availability and access to major roads.
Talegaon Is Emerging as a Strategic Industrial Location
Talegaon has also become an important destination for businesses looking for industrial and warehouse properties around Pune. The area’s proximity to major manufacturing clusters and transportation routes makes it suitable for companies involved in manufacturing, logistics, automotive components and distribution. As businesses look for larger facilities outside highly congested urban areas, locations such as Talegaon can offer opportunities to secure larger warehouse footprints.
The growth of surrounding industrial development is also increasing the need for supporting logistics infrastructure. Businesses can benefit from positioning warehouses closer to their manufacturing or distribution networks, potentially improving supply-chain efficiency.

Ranjangaon Is Strengthening Its Industrial Ecosystem
Ranjangaon is another location attracting attention from industrial and logistics businesses. The area is known for its industrial development and proximity to important transportation routes. Manufacturing companies operating in and around Ranjangaon require warehouses for raw materials, components, finished products and distribution. This creates opportunities for warehouse owners and developers to cater to businesses looking for strategically located industrial space.
As industrial activity expands, logistics operators can benefit from being positioned close to manufacturing facilities rather than transporting goods over longer distances from central Pune. The rapid evolution of e-commerce is another major factor behind the growing demand for warehouses.
Traditional warehousing focused primarily on storing large quantities of products. Modern e-commerce logistics requires much more flexibility. Businesses need facilities that can handle inventory management, order processing, packaging, returns and rapid dispatch.
Quick-commerce has further increased the importance of strategically located distribution facilities. Instead of relying only on large centralized warehouses, some businesses are developing networks of smaller facilities closer to consumers.
This shift is creating demand for warehouse properties in different parts of Pune. Industrial hubs remain important for large-scale storage, while locations closer to residential and commercial areas can support faster last-mile distribution.
